Amazon and NVIDIA are rolling out a new AI service that could benefit the iGaming space
Artificial intelligence (AI) appears to be at the center of innovation in a new partnership between Amazon Web Services (AWS) and NVIDIA. According to a press release from both companies issued yesterday, the “next-generation” infrastructure will be optimized for large language model (LLM) training and generative AI application development. “Generative AI has awakened companies to reimagine their products and business models and to be the disruptor and not the disrupted. We are thrilled to combine our expertise, scale and reach to help customers harness accelerated computing and generative AI to engage the enormous opportunities ahead,” NVIDIA founder and CEO Jensen Huang said in the release.
The new alliance between the two tech giants is intended to power question answering, image and video generation, code generation, speech recognition and other demanding generative AI applications.
